This poor man called, and the Lord heard him; He saved him out of all his troubles.

- Psalm 34:6

 

I love music, almost all genres of music (almost), it just speaks to me. 

No matter how I am feeling or what I am gong through, I am guaranteed to find a song to make me laugh or cry, what ever I seem to need in the moment.

There is a secular artist popular in the 70’s, Carole King, who wrote and recorded “You’ve Got A Friend”:

You know, God want’s you to call Him when you are down and troubled, call out His name.  

God loves you so much, and yes, He wants to be your friend, and He will be there when nothing is going right.

What are you waiting for?
